""On The Diseases Of The Kidney: Their Pathology, Diagnosis, And Treatment"" is a medical book written by George Johnson in 1852. The book provides a comprehensive overview of the various kidney diseases, their causes, symptoms, diagnosis, and treatment options available at the time. The author covers topics such as the anatomy and physiology of the kidney, inflammation of the kidney, urinary tract infections, and the different types of kidney stones. The book also includes detailed descriptions of the various treatment options available, including the use of diuretics, bloodletting, and surgical procedures. Throughout the book, Johnson emphasizes the importance of early detection and prompt treatment in managing kidney diseases. The book is written in a clear and concise manner, making it accessible to both medical professionals and the general public.
